Yuvraj Singh Summoned by Ed Online Gaming App: Former Indian cricket team player Yuvraj Singh has been called to ED’s office. According to the PTI report, Yuvraj Singh has reached the Enforcement Directorate office today at 12 noon on Tuesday, 23 September. Yuvraj has been called to the ED office for questioning in the online batting app case. In this case, the first Indian cricket team star players Suresh Raina and Shikhar Dhawan have also received summons and have also questioned these players.
Apart from Yuvraj, these people summons ED
India’s star batsman Yuvraj Singh has been called for questioning in the investigation of the online betting gaming app case. The ED is continuously interrogating many people in this case. Among the Indian players, Suresh Raina, Robin Uthappa and Shikhar Dhawan have also been questioned by the ED. At the same time, former TMC MP and Bengali actress Mimi Chakraborty, actor Ankush Hazra has also been called for questioning. Bollywood actor Sonu Sood has been called for questioning on Wednesday, September 24.
New law of Government of India
The Government of India has enacted a new law in the online gaming app case. Under this law, the government will take strict action against those running online money gaming apps and have also banned promoting it. If a person or organization promotes these betting apps, a fine will also be imposed against them and will also be sentenced to jail.
The ED wants to check the cheating of crores of rupees by examining the players and the rest of the stars in this case. In this case, many more people can be questioned further. The ED has not shared any major information after the inquiry so far.
